On 11 February 2023, the Kings Cross Steelers RFC will be hosting an event in memoriam of Simon Dunn who was an integral member of the KXS 1st XV team between 2016-2018. Simon grew up playing rugby league and then converted to rugby union, playing for the Sydney Convicts for over 10 years. But those few years playing with us, the Steelers, left a mark on him that made him incredibly proud to have played for our club and contributed to the 1st XV undefeated season of 2017/2018. Something he continued to fondly talk about for years after and always expressed his love for the club and how much he missed playing with us.
Simon thrived on the pitch and during the post-game social (maybe, sometimes too much…ha!), where he definitely brought life to the party and a smile to your face. On the pitch, he was a beast to contend with and someone you didn’t want to be tackled by. Even to the point where a fellow rugby player even questioned if he was “really gay” because he tackled so hard. But off the pitch, he was as harmless as a butterfly with a sharp tongue that kept you on your toes.
Simon, unfortunately, passed away on 21 January 2023 at the incredibly young age of 35.
We would like to invite all that knew him, of him and even played on the pitch with him to join us on 11 February at West Ham where we will commemorate him. The two games at Home will be in memoriam of what Simon loved the most; competitive rugby and a sport that breaks down barriers. They kick off at 2pm. After which, we will have a few post-game speeches, including a few anecdotes to spark some laughter and hold up many drinks to his name to remember Simon for who he was. He’s a Steeler, he’s True Blue.
